Epilogue

Jackson

If I was being honest with myself I'd say that taking up the position a few years back with Charli was one of the best decisions I ever made. Technically she really didn't even need me around since she managed to fight her way through everything.

I look up and watch as she pushes the new couch across our living room floor, yes I said our living room.

After we got back to New York she moved in with me just outside of the city; her mum still being insanely bossy which I don't think will ever change.

Charli's decided to try her luck in getting involved in my line of work which at first I was a little hesitant to let her. I honestly don't think anything can stop her from doing what she wants now though. After she broke that wall down and finally stood up to her mum, she's become stronger, braver.

We decided to move right into the city and found a nice 3 bedroom apartment with a shared garage on the bottom floor, and a roof top terrace.

After Vince was arrested and denied bail he spent his time in and out of court where the evidence just stacked up against him; he was found guilty for numerous offences.

Since he no longer works at the agency, I applied for his position and hired Marty as one of the new trainers and recruiters. It'll be a little funny to watch Marty try and train Charli, but I think she's grateful that he was there that night and not more guys like Dodge.
